What is SkyCiv?- Engineering Analysis Software
- 2013 - Started a website with a simple calculator
- 2015 - Released SkyCiv Engineering and 4 more programs
- Monthly Subscriptions
- Cloud Based

CHALLENGESAEC Specific
- Construction is a slow to move industry
- Engineering Companies aren’t actively seeking new software, they have purchased already
- Lack of Reputation
- Reluctance to adopt new technology in software
![Page 9: Introduction to SkyCiv and Innovation in the AEC Industry - April, 2016](https://reader035.vdocument.in/reader035/viewer/2022062503/587fe6a61a28ab46228b5821/html5/thumbnails/9.jpg)
Slow to Move
- Computer Engineering leads change, followed by automotive and aircraft
- AEC slowest to move
- Not adopting this technology is costing construction industry $16b
- Why?- Construction processes are
complex
- No two jobs are ever the same
- Reluctance to change
